Breaking: Berlin Philharmonic appoints its first Chinese member
NewsThe audition for the position of first principal viola in the Berlin Philharmonic Orchestra was won this week by Diyang Mei, presently principal viola of the Munich Philharmonic.
Mei, 27 and from Hunan, is the first Chinese natonal in the orchestra.
He won first prize in the 2018 ARD competition and has played ever since in Munich.The Munich Phil say they are letting him go ‘with one eye crying and the other smiling.’
